Samuel Atkinson Waterston was born on November 15, 1940 in Cambridge, Massachusetts, USA. He entered Yale University in 1958 and graduated in 1962 with a bachelor’s degree in history and French. After university, Waterston moved to New York, where he played in theater and on Broadway, earning a living not only on stage.
